(Mid - Senior) Legal Associate

We are expanding our AIFM team in Luxembourg and se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Legal Associate (Mid to Senior level, depending on experience) to join our Legal department. This role offers an excellent opportunity to grow within the legal and regulatory framework of alternative investment funds.

You will gain hands-on experience in a dynamic, client-facing environment and work closely with junior and senior members of the AIFM Legal team. The role involves supporting key onboarding, legal, and operational tasks while developing skills in client management, communication, teamwork, and analytical thinking

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

• Actively participate in the review and negotiation of service agreements for a third party host AIFM (e.g., AIFM Agreements, Investment Advisory Agreements, Delegated Portfolio Management Agreements, engagement letters, NDAs, etc.);
• Review and assist in the negotiation of fund constitutional documents (e.g., limited partnership agreements, private placement memorandums, articles of association, and other fund-related legal documents);
• Support the operations and oversight of pre marketing and marketing activities for various funds;
• Undertake ad hoc and ancillary activities related to a third party Host AIFM, including preparation of team meeting minutes, legal document management, coordination with other Langham Hall departments, assistance with board meeting preparations, legal and regulatory research, and drafting or updating internal policies and procedures;
• Provide coaching and conduct review of work performed by junior team members.

Technical Knowledge / Skills Required

• University degree in Law;
• Up to 3 years of experience within an AIFM, law firm (investment funds practice), or the Luxembourg funds industry;
• Prior exposure to AIFMD;
• Strong analytical skills;
• Excellent verbal and written communication abilities;
• Strong interpersonal skills;
• Solid organisational skills;
• Proactive mindset with the ability to work autonomously;
• High attention to detail and an inquisitive, problem solving approach
